Queens University of Charlotte, founded in 1857, is a private North Carolina institution offering business, arts, sciences, and health programs. With strong local internship opportunities, it focuses on personalized education, experiential learning, and community engagement.

Queens offers a range of scholarships, including merit-based, talent-based, and need-based awards. These include the Presidential Scholarship, Dean’s Scholarship, and Athletic Scholarships, among others.
Yes. Queens University provides merit scholarships and limited need-based aid to international students, based on academic achievement and financial documentation submitted during admission.
Students can apply for financial aid by completing the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A). This helps determine eligibility for federal, state, and institutional aid programs.
